Comment puis-je lire une cassette à bobine des années 1970?


38

Un ami proche de ma mère a travaillé au DEC dans les années 1970 et 1980. Elle est récemment décédée et, en triant dans son domaine, ma mère a découvert une bande magnétique de bobine à bobine. Nous sommes curieux de savoir ce qu'il pourrait y avoir. Je n'ai pas encore vu de photo, mais Wikipedia me dit que c'est probablement DECtape .

Y a-t-il une chance que les données à ce sujet soient encore bonnes? Il n'a pas été préservé avec beaucoup de soin, mais, autant que nous sachions, il n'a jamais été particulièrement maltraité. Je viens de partir dans une boîte et déplacé plusieurs fois.

Si les données sont toujours valables, faut-il extraire un PDP ou un VAX, le lire ou existe-t-il une option plus moderne?


9
Oh, peut-être que cet ami était un espion d’une grande entreprise, transmettant des secrets de haute technologie à l’URSS, ferait un bon livre. ; ->
Moab

1
Je suis curieux @JoeWreschnig ... Avez-vous pu récupérer les données?
James Mertz

4
Je suppose qu'il n'y a pas d'application pour ça ...
Ivo Flipse

Nous n'avons pas encore essayé. J'espérais silencieusement que quelqu'un aurait été assez fou pour construire un lecteur DECtape -> USB ou quelque chose d'aussi simple, mais maintenant cela est entré dans le domaine "d'un projet" plutôt que "d'une curiosité" et, comme la plupart des geeks, ma liste de projets est déjà un mile de long.

Nous ne l'avons toujours pas lu, mais nous avons trouvé des documents qui suggèrent fortement que le contenu est un compilateur Pascal, probablement dans le sens de la réponse de Sam.

Réponses:


19

Si la bande est DECtape, vous devez absolument trouver un lecteur TU-56 pour la lire. Les unités TU-56 seront difficiles à trouver et nécessiteront probablement des réparations (remplacement d'anciens condensateurs, câblage en décomposition, voyants grillés). En ce qui concerne les hôtes, vous aurez beaucoup plus de chances de trouver un vax qui fonctionne qu'un pdp-8 qui fonctionne, mais vous aurez besoin de la bonne carte d'interface (vraisemblablement Qbus pour les plus petits vax). La densité de bits est relativement faible, à environ 350 bpi et le signal est codé en manchester. Si vous pouvez obtenir les données d’une autre manière, vous pouvez certainement les insérer dans un pdp ou vax émulé (voir simh-vax, fonctionne très bien: simh. trailing-edge.com/vax.html). Si vous êtes très dur, vous pouvez construire la carte d’interface vous-même: http://so-much-stuff.com/pdp8/cad/projects/boards.html . Pour plus d'informations sur le lecteur TU-56:http://www.pdp8.net/tu56/tu56.shtml . Cela représente beaucoup d’efforts pour environ 184 000 mots de données. Vous voudrez peut-être essayer comp.sys.dec pour voir si quelqu'un a des tu-56 traînant dans les parages, et j'appuie certainement la recommandation de contacter un musée d'histoire de l'informatique.


12
Je ne sais pas si j'ai déjà vu autant de termes archaïques au même endroit. Vous devriez changer votre nom pour Time Machine!
ubiquibacon

17

Les dectapes sont facilement différenciables des rubans à rouleaux ouverts standard, car ils avaient 1 pouce de large et un diamètre de 4 à 5 pouces, et les rebords une profondeur d’un demi-pouce.

Dectape était l’un des supports les plus robustes de son époque, sinon le plus robuste. Il comportait des pistes de données et de synchronisation redondantes et pouvait être lu ou écrit dans les deux sens. Les vendeurs épataient les clients potentiels en frappant la bande - plusieurs fois! - avec un perforateur manuel et en montrant que la bande était toujours lisible. Un des vendeurs me dit: Après la démonstration de Paper-punch, un client a également demandé si elle était étanche à l’eau. Le vendeur nous a dit qu’il n’en avait aucune idée, mais pour le plaisir, il en a laissé tomber un dans un seau d’eau et a emmené le client déjeuner. Quand ils seront rentrés, a-t-il dit, il l'avait suspendue au lecteur et l'avait lue - avec succès! - pendant que l'eau coulait dans toutes les directions.

Il n'avait pas besoin de marqueurs collants (les pistes de chronométrage contenaient toutes les informations de position nécessaires), mais vous aurez besoin d'un lecteur Dectape et d'une machine DEC ou plus pour le faire fonctionner (à moins que vous ne soyez prêt à relever le défi de la création d'une interface. et écrire les pilotes de bande de bas niveau pour cela).


"Gee, je me demande si un disque dur est assez robuste pour tomber dans un seau d'eau et ensuite courir juste après"
James Mertz



7

Je travaille pour une société spécialisée dans le support des systèmes existants, et nous avons récemment participé à un projet de migration de données de plusieurs centaines de bandes 1/2 "sur des supports modernes. La date à laquelle le support a été écrit à l'origine variait du milieu des années 1980 au plus tard. Il y a quelques années à peine, nous avions un taux de réussite d'environ 75%, mais je n'ai aucune statistique permettant de montrer le taux de réussite par rapport à l'âge des bandes ou des données.

Vous trouverez toujours de nombreuses entreprises qui utilisent encore de tels équipements, certaines institutions financières en ont encore, de même que plusieurs entreprises utilisant des systèmes de contrôle industriels, mais les chances de trouver celle qui est disposée à aider sont plutôt minces, l'équipement est très coûteux à maintenir en raison de son âge.

Je dirais que la réponse de Chris est probablement votre option la plus réaliste, mais pour être honnête, je doute qu'un musée d'histoire de l'informatique dispose d'un système pleinement fonctionnel, car les équipements de cet âge nécessitent vraiment beaucoup de maintenance.


5

Il devrait être possible de lire ces vieilles bandes en utilisant une limaille de fer très fine, puis en photographiant les motifs de mèches qui deviennent visibles. Évidemment, ce n’est pas un moyen rapide d’obtenir les données, mais c’est faisable sur de vieilles bandes, car leur densité était bien inférieure à celle des supports magnétiques actuels.


Je l'ai fait assez récemment sur une bande de 1/2 ", non pour tenter de récupérer des données, mais pour démontrer que c'était possible. J'ai oublié le nom du produit, mais il s'agissait essentiellement d'un liquide rempli de particules de manganèse. cela rendra impossible la lecture de la bande si vous trouvez plus tard une unité de bande
Bryan

Vous devez également prendre en compte la méthode de codage utilisée sur la bande, car celle-ci sera probablement codée en phase ( en.wikipedia.org/wiki/Phase_encoding ) ou NRZI ( en.wikipedia.org/wiki/NRZI ) - autrement dit , ne vous attendez pas à voir une série de 1 et 0 qui se traduira par ASCII
Bryan

4

Avant d’entreprendre cette tâche, pensez-vous que les données sont VRAIMENT lues? Plusieurs personnes vous ont fourni de bonnes données sur la possibilité de pouvoir les lire.

Mais il est fort probable que ce ne soit que des bandes de sauvegarde d'une ancienne base de données ou quelque chose d'aussi banal, et même si vous pouvez lire les données, celles-ci seront indéchiffrables.

Ce n’est pas comme si vous alliez lire cette cassette et c’est plein de secrets d’entreprise fous ou de réponse à la vie, à l’univers et à tout le reste.


Je suis absolument sûr que ça va contenir plus que '42'!
Fretje

3

Vous aurez besoin du matériel pour les bandes. En outre, les marqueurs de début / fin étaient des autocollants adhésifs placés à l’arrière du ruban et utilisés pour l’alignement optique (appelé "fin du ruban"). Si ces autocollants se sont détachés, la bande ne pourrait plus être lue. Je ne me souviens pas si DecTapes les avait, mais les autres (cassettes 7 et 9 pistes) les avaient. J'avais des boîtes de chaque type de cassette et j'ai jeté toutes les miennes au milieu des années 90.


Les marqueurs de mon expérience ne sont utilisés que pour BOT (début de bande), les marqueurs de fin de bande (marques de fichier AKA) sont généralement écrits sur le support sous forme de modèle de données spécifique. Les marqueurs BOT ne sont que des étiquettes réfléchissantes, puisqu'un capteur optique situé près de la tête de lecture / écriture détecte une réflexion provenant d'une source de lumière. Les chances que ces étiquettes disparaissent sont plutôt minces, du moins je ne l'ai jamais vu arriver.
Bryan

Non, il y a aussi un marqueur réfléchissant EOT. Il était normalement placé environ 20 pieds avant l'EOT physique. Pendant les écritures, le lecteur signalera "le succès, mais nous avons passé EOT" quand il voit cela passer. Le logiciel d'écriture est alors censé écrire une marque de bande, une étiquette de fin de volume (aucune étiquette de fin de fichier sauf s'il s'agit du dernier bloc du fichier par coïncidence) et deux autres marques de bande iirc. Le logiciel de lecture détecte l'étiquette EOV et sait qu'il ne faut pas essayer de lire davantage, mais rembobine la bande et demande le volume suivant. (J'ai peut-être manqué quelques détails ici, mais l'essentiel est correct.)
Jamie Hanrahan

2

Il semblerait que les gens aient mentionné l'âge des bandes et, comme facteurs, j'ajouterai un facteur supplémentaire.

En fin de compte, si vous pouvez accéder aux données d'octet, il s'agit probablement d'enregistrements de longueur fixe. Recherchez des modèles courants pour identifier les en-têtes. S'il s'agit d'une longueur variable, il y aura un type d'en-tête commun. Au-delà de cela, chaque bit sera un drapeau, cela remonte au temps où le stockage de données - y compris les programmes - était extrêmement coûteux.

Malheureusement, les piles de cartes perforées (désolé de coller des bandes avec des cartes perforées), je sais que les gens qui les gardaient étaient généralement du programme assembleur lui-même. C’était le plan nucléaire nucléaire - si tout le reste échouait - ils pourraient ramener l’assembleur sur la boîte et commencer à taper pour faire avancer les choses.

Je déteste dire qu'il est si peu probable de contenir quelque chose de précieux maintenant - principalement à cause de sa taille. Vous pouvez probablement taper une de ces bandes en utilisant notepad / ascii en moins de 10 ou 20 minutes pour un vrai typeur.

En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.